> David I S Mandala wrote:
> > Once you get the mouse to work directly connected you still might have
> > an issue when you attach it to the KVM. Depending upon which version of
> > Linux and X I'm running I have to disconnect and reconnect my mouse or
> > switch to virtual console 1 and back to 7 and then the mouse works. It's
> > odd but it's something I live with daily with my Belkin Omni Cube 4-Port
> > KVM. 
> 
> Some KVM's don't maintain power to the mouse as they switch from one PC to
> another.  Some mice don't care - but others suffer a reset and because
> neither PC provides them with an initialisation sequence, the mouse either
> doesn't work or behaves weirdly.
> 

I can confirm that, the Belkin drops power to the mouse when switching,
the mouse is a Microsoft IntellMouse Explorer 3.0 USB / PS2 mouse. The
LED in the mouse goes away when switching between machines.


> Your various tricks that fix the problem are presumably fooling the software
> into sending another initialisation string.
> 
> It's hard to track the problem down because it requires BOTH a KVM that glitches
> the power AND a mouse that needs an initialisation string.  Hence, changing to
> a better KVM or a different mouse might fix it - but it's a bit hit and miss.
> 

For the money it will cost, not worth it at the moment. Since I figured
out how to force the thing to work it's OK. I am going to add a
momentary push button switch to the circuit so I can interupt the power
more easily however.

> The same thing can happen with keyboards too.
